Cobblestone Hotel & Suites - Urbana
40.09338, -83.75546The 3-star Cobblestone Hotel & Suites - Urbana, located approximately 25 minutes' stroll from Urbana Monument Square Historic District, boasts an indoor pool and a fitness studio. This unpretentious hotel offers 56 rooms in a business area of Urbana.
Location
The Urbana hotel is conveniently situated 3.1 miles from Champaign Aviation Museum. There is Johnny Appleseed Education Center and Museum about 30 minutes by foot from the Urbana accommodation.
For those traveling from afar, James M. Cox Dayton International airport is 48 minutes' drive away.
Rooms
Some rooms provide a coffee maker as well as WiFi and a TV to help you enjoy your stay. A microwave and a fridge are available upon request.
Eat & Drink
Guests can enjoy time in the snack bar.
